## ProctorQueue incident response — Veridex Exams

When the proctoring queue on Veridex backs up past the alert threshold, the usual cause is a stalled session-review worker holding its lease. Confirm worker liveness first, then check whether the Marrowgate region is lagging on replication before draining anything. Draining without that check has previously duplicated exam flags. After liveness is confirmed, restart the consumers with the configuration settings reproduced directly below for reference.

settings of yagap-tafof:
ulawyn:
  log_level: debug
  metrics_host: metrics.ulawyn.tolvaqsys.internal
  pool_size: 16

**Visitor Policy — Holiday Hours**

Quick heads-up for the festive stretch: Marlow Court runs short hours from 23 December to 3 January, so the front doors open 10:00 and lock at 16:00. Visitors still need to be signed in and escorted — no exceptions, even if they "just need five minutes." Pre-booked visits only; walk-ins should be politely rebooked for January. If a visitor arrives while the doors are already locked, let them in through the side entrance using the code below.

turnstile pass: bdg-R-53

Welcome to the Pipewren gateway team! One thing you'll bump into fast: we enable permessage-deflate on our websocket layer, but only for payloads over 1KB. Compression saves bandwidth on the big telemetry frames, but it chews CPU and opens up context-takeover memory costs, so don't crank the window size without load-testing on the Brindlemoor staging cluster first. The compression handshake also needs a signing credential. Add the following line to your .env before booting the gateway:

sealed setting: LEDGER_TOKEN13=5d842615a26d7